Battles in the Shadow
1938 film From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Battles in the Shadow (Italian: Lotte nell'ombra) is a 1938 Italian spy thriller film directed by Domenico Gambino and starring Antonio Centa, Dria Paola and Paola Barbara.[1] It was shot at the Cinecittà Studios in Rome. The film's sets were designed by the art director Giorgio Pinzauti.

Synopsis
A group of foreign agents steal a formula for a new explosive, then kidnap the scientist's secretary to try and force her to decode the blueprints.
